![](https://img-blog.csdnimg.cn/20201014180756928.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
SpringBoot
xiaowen5555555
这个作者很懒,什么都没留下…
展开
-
Param ‘serviceName‘ is illegal, serviceName is blank
Param ‘serviceName’ is illegal, serviceName is blank原创 2022-08-12 07:50:04 · 3198 阅读 · 1 评论 -
读不到nacos配置中心数据
读不到nacos配置中心数据原创 2022-07-12 14:21:09 · 3159 阅读 · 0 评论 -
错误:java.lang.AbstractMethodError:xxxxxxxxx.ServiceInstance
错误 : java.lang.AbstractMethodError: org.springframework.cloud.netflix.ribbon.RibbonLoadBalancerClient.choose(Ljava/lang/String;Lorg/springframework/cloud/client/loadbalancer/Request;)Lorg/springframework/cloud/client/ServiceInstance;原创 2022-07-11 23:38:29 · 857 阅读 · 0 评论 -
No Feign Client for loadBalancing defined. Did you forget to include spring-cloud-starter-loadbalanc
No Feign Client for loadBalancing defined. Did you forget to include spring-cloud-starter-loadbalancer?原创 2022-07-11 23:16:36 · 266 阅读 · 0 评论 -
Consul注册中心注册的服务总是红叉 (All service checks failing)
Consul注册中心注册的服务总是红叉 (All service checks failing)原创 2022-06-12 11:03:28 · 1930 阅读 · 0 评论 -
SpringBoot解决Swagger2出现No mapping for GET /swagger-ui.html
SpringBoot解决Swagger2出现No mapping for GET /swagger-ui.htmlspringBoot配置Swagger2出现页面无法访问错误:No mapping for GET /swagger-ui.html如果继承了WebMvcConfigurationSupport,则在yml中配置的相关内容会失效。 需要重新指定静态资源在当前继承WebMvcConfigurationSupport、WebMvcConfigurer的配置类加上如下代码:@Overr原创 2021-07-02 10:28:08 · 1194 阅读 · 0 评论 -
记录一次Eureka在线扩容引发的异常
原因分析:     1.Eureka server端没有启动,而在使用了@EnableDiscoveryClient或者@EnableEurekaClient,改client端会去寻找eureka server端,没有找到就会抛出下面异常  &n原创 2019-03-07 22:47:53 · 784 阅读 · 0 评论 -
Spring Boot-关闭Banner
停用banner的三种方法 1).main方法中的内容修改为: 2).使用fluent API 修改为 3).在 application.yml 或 application.properties文件中配置 在.yml 文件中配置如下 spring:main:banner-mode: "off" 在.prop...原创 2018-07-18 14:13:30 · 7918 阅读 · 1 评论 -
Spring Boot在使用Gradle build命令卡住不动了
Spring Boot执行gradle build的时候卡在tests completed这里没有动了。XXX-api>gradle build<===========--> 85% EXECUTING [23s]> :XXX-api:test > 0 tests completed> :XXX-api:test > Executing tes原创 2018-07-24 13:27:10 · 7922 阅读 · 1 评论 -
Spring Boot-修改Banner
1).在项目的src/main/resources下新建banner.txt 2).通过 [http://patorjk.com/software/taag](http://patorjk.com/software/taag%20http://patorjk.com/software/taag) 选择自己喜欢文字 3.复制网站中的结果,粘贴到项目中的banner.txt 4...原创 2018-07-18 14:17:44 · 5869 阅读 · 0 评论 -
Spring Boot集成Log4j2.yml
1).Gradle依赖build.gradle配置 去掉默认日志,加载其他日志,spring boot提供log4j2的解决方案,如下配置:subprojects节点中加入----------------configurations { all*.exclude module: 'spring-boot-starter-logging'}dependencies {...原创 2018-07-24 09:23:01 · 4675 阅读 · 0 评论 -
Spring-Boot中集成FastJson Gradle项目
1).build.gradle文件中加入下面配置dependencies { compile("com.alibaba:fastjson:${fastjsonVersion}")} 2).创建一个类用来配置FastJson@Configurationpublic class FastJsonConf implements WebMvcConfigurer {...原创 2018-07-29 15:59:41 · 12641 阅读 · 0 评论 -
Spring Boot 字符集设置 解决中文乱码方案
使用spring-boot开发时,有时候程序没事,往往不经意会造成中文到前端变成乱码(????这样情况) Spring Boot修改编码方法: 1).在application.properties里面配置spring.http.encoding.charset=UTF-8spring.http.encoding.force=truespring.http.enc...原创 2018-07-29 16:07:16 · 22329 阅读 · 2 评论 -
SpringBoot 普通类中如何获取其他bean
工具类import org.springframework.beans.BeansException;import org.springframework.context.ApplicationContext;import org.springframework.context.ApplicationContextAware;import org.springframework.st...原创 2018-08-02 09:38:16 · 4758 阅读 · 0 评论 -
SpringBoot集成Druid、开启Druid监控、去除内置广告
build.gradle文件中加入下面配置dependencies { implementation "com.alibaba:druid-spring-boot-starter:${druidStarterVersion}"}如何开启druid在application-dev.yml中新增以下内容 spring: datasource: druid: # class name driver-class-name: com.mysql..原创 2020-12-10 20:01:17 · 612 阅读 · 1 评论 -
SpringBoot设置跨域的几种方式
SpringBoot设置跨域的几种方式单个Controller及方法:全局跨域:1. 过滤器Filter2. 设置CorsConfiguration3. WebMvcConfigurer4. 自定义拦截器重写请求单个Controller及方法:@CrossOrigin作为一个强大的注解,特点就是不仅支持在controller中设置,还支持方法级注解。而最简单也最直接的方法,那就是在controller中直接加入。@CrossOrigin(origins = "*",allowCredentials原创 2020-12-10 20:23:19 · 508 阅读 · 0 评论